Only 19 horses are slated to compete at Saturday's Kentucky Derby at Churchill Downs. Why is that? That might seem like a lower number than usual, but The Puma was scratched for an illness on Saturday morning.
That's the fourth horse to leave the field before the annual Run for the Roses. Right to Party, Silent Tactic and Fulleffort have also been scratched before this year's Kentucky Derby. Four horses leaving the field seems like a lot, but that just gives the 19 horses in competition better odds to win the race outright.
